LEGO DC Super-Villains is the upcoming fourth installment in the LEGO DC Videogame series. It will be released on October 16, 2018 on Nintendo Switch, Playstation 4, Xbox One, and PC in North America, and October 19, 2018 elsewhere.

Plot
Whilst en route to Stryker's Island with a "special subject," Commissioner Gordon receives word from Detective Renee Montoya that The Joker has broken into Wayne Tech. Dismissing this to focus on the task at hand, Gordon proceeds to Metropolis. Arriving at Stryker's Island, he meets with the incarcerated Lex Luthor, seeking assistance regarding a very peculiar suspect. This mysterious individual had been apprehended following a break in at a laboratory previously owned by Professor Ivo, a colleague of Luthor. Ivo and Luthor had both taken part in the 'Amazo' Project, an android capable of stealing powers from heroes.
The mysterious individual arrives accompanied by Lex Luthor's personal body guard, Mercy Graves, disguised as a security guard. Mercy reveals herself to those present, and successfully releases both Lex and the rookie villain from custody. The trio proceeds throughout the penitentiary, reuniting with Cheetah and Solomon Grundy along the way. The group delves further into the facility to break out Metallo, who is able to apprehend Superman following his arrival. They proceed out to the coast, followed by the newly released prisoners, where they are intercepted by the remaining members of the Justice League, sans Batman.
Meanwhile, following the Wayne Tech break in, The Joker and Harley Quinn are captured by Batman in the Batwing. Caught in the battle between the newly released inmates and the Justice League, the Batwing crashes, and Batman is chased away by Grundy. In an attempt to flee the area, The Joker and Harley climb the Gotham City Clocktower and board the Jokercopter. Their victory is short lived however, as they soon crash into Lex and Mercy, landing on a nearby rooftop. Suddenly, the released inmates are all defeated with ease by a new group of individuals, calling themselves the "Justice Syndicate," who each appear to be physically similar to a member of the Justice League...

Trivia
Notes
- This is the first LEGO game to focus entirely on villains, similar to the villain levels featured in LEGO Batman: The Videogame.
- The game's release also marks the 10th anniversary of LEGO Batman: The Videogame.
- This is the first LEGO game featuring a custom character in the main story.
- The stud bonus in each level is called "True Villain", as opposed to "True Hero" from both LEGO Batman 2: DC Super Heroes and LEGO Batman 3: Beyond Gotham.
- The game's storyline takes influence from the New 52 storyline, "Forever Evil" which ran from 2013-2014, with the inclusion of the Crime Syndicate of America and the game's focus on Villains.
- Another influence from the game's storyline includes the pre-Rebirth series, "The Darkseid War" which ran from 2015-2016, due to the inclusion of Lex Luthor's Superman warsuit and Darkseid's daughter, Grail.
- Like LEGO Batman 3: Beyond Gotham, several voice actors reprise their roles from other DC properties, such as the animated Justice League series for example.
- Game director Arthur Parsons stated that the game utilizes an "All Star" voice cast. Parsons describes his excitement on the game's cast as the best one that he ever worked on in any LEGO game the company done.
- The hub world consists of multiple iconic locations from the DC Universe, such as Gotham City, Metropolis, Arkham Asylum, Stryker's Island, Belle Reve, the Justice League Watchtower, Smallville, Gorilla City, Themyscira, S.T.A.R. Labs and Apokolips.
- In order to keep Mark Hamill's involvement under wraps, Christopher Corey Smith, who voiced The Joker in LEGO Batman 2: DC Super Heroes, LEGO Batman 3: Beyond Gotham and LEGO Dimensions provided the voice of the character in the announcement trailer until Hamill's voice was officially revealed at E3 2018.
- To coincide with the trailer's villainous theme, the music that was played in the trailer was "One Way Or Another" by Blondie.
- Both Lois Lane and Jimmy Olsen serve as mission briefing before each level as a nod to J. Jonah Jameson's Webcast in LEGO Marvel Super Heroes 2.
References
- Some level titles reference various things in pop culture:
- "New Kid on the Block" references the American boy band, New Kids on the Block
- "Fight at the Museum" is a reference to the film series, Night at the Museum
Credits
Voice Cast
- Anthony Ingruber[2]
- Bumper Robinson[3] - Cyborg
- C. Thomas Howell[4] - Reverse Flash
- Christopher Swindle[5]
- Clancy Brown[6] - Lex Luthor
- Cree Summer[7][8] - Mercy Graves, Livewire
- David Sobolov[9][10] - Gorilla Grodd, Lobo
- Dee Bradley Baker[11]
- Erica Luttrell[12] - Cheetah
- Fred Tatasciore[13][14] - Ares, Black Adam, Black Manta, Clayface, Doomsday, Killer Croc, King Shark, Mongul, Perry White, Solomon Grundy
- Gilbert Gottfried[15] - Mr. Mxyzptlk
- Gina Torres[16] - Superwoman
- Greg Miller[17]
- Grey Griffin[11] - Catwoman
- James Horan[18] - Heat Wave
- J.B. Blanc[19] - Solovar
- Jennifer Hale[20] - Killer Frost
- John Barrowman[21] - Malcolm Merlyn
- Josh Keaton[7] - Green Lantern
- Julie Nathanson[22] - Silver Banshee
- Kevin Conroy[7] - Batman
- Mark Hamill[7] - The Joker
- Mark Rolston[23] - Deathstroke
- Max Mittelman[24] - Jimmy Olsen
- Michael Dorn[25] - Kalibak
- Michael Ironside[26] - Darkseid
- Michael Rosenbaum[7] - The Flash
- Nolan North[27] - Ultraman
- Scott Porter[28] - Aquaman
- Susan Eisenberg[7] - Wonder Woman
- Steve Blum[29] - Captain Cold
- Tara Strong[30] - Harley Quinn
- Tasia Valenza[31][32] - Poison Ivy
- Tom Kane[7] - Commissioner Gordon
- Travis Willingham[7] - Superman
- Vanessa Marshall[33] - Renee Montoya
- Wally Wingert[34] - The Riddler
